Output c21b2edfa2ecbb9c7745822ae461f0ef88ffdf3f97d93d0253e25c3ed4a08f07:1

value
6380671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883b5e31bf8439a2a5ba2aad6e5d915b1465211e OP_EQUAL
address
3E7LwbAoCMP7m3kw87De4LWBscjD8ko1Fi
transaction
c21b2edfa2ecbb9c7745822ae461f0ef88ffdf3f97d93d0253e25c3ed4a08f07
confirmations
378174
spent
true